Weather in August

The weather in August in Bávaro, Dominican Republic, mirrors that of July with marginally elevated temperatures. Tropical climate elements persist with the month experiencing significant humidity levels, rainfall peaks, and high sea temperatures. August sees a further increase in rainfall from July, arriving at an impressive 131mm (5.16"). Moving from August to September, the weather relieves some rainfall while maintaining the tropical theme. Sunshine hours in August measure an approximately 9h each day, making it an ideal vacation spot.

Temperature

Bávaro's weather in August displays an average high-temperature of a still warm 29.5°C (85.1°F), showing minor disparity from July's 29.3°C (84.7°F). Throughout the nights in August, Bávaro notes an average low of 26.5°C (79.7°F), a small dip from the daytime peak.

Heat index

The heat index value for August is evaluated at a fiery hot 36°C (96.8°F). Implement additional cautionary measures, heat cramps and heat exhaustion could occur. Prolonged activity might induce heatstroke.
Thinking about the heat index, one should account for its values in shaded areas with gentle breezes. Being under direct sunlight might amplify the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'real feel' or 'felt air temperature', is a calculation that merges air temperature and relative humidity to depict the sensation of warmth. One's perception of temperature can vary depending on physical activity and individual heat sensitivity, influenced by factors like wind, attire, and metabolic variations. You should know that direct sun exposure can heighten weather effects, potentially elevating the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are largely significant for babies and toddlers. Young ones often do not realize the necessity to rest and replenish their fluids. Thirst is a delayed indication of dehydration - keeping hydrated, particularly in prolonged physical activity, is crucial.
One way the human body deals with excessive warmth is by perspiring and allowing sweat to evaporate. Under conditions of high relative humidity, the rate of evaporation decreases. This results in the body retaining more heat than under conditions of dry air. When body heat isn't effectively managed, risks of dehydration and overheating amplify.

Humidity

The months with the highest humidity in Bávaro, Dominican Republic, are May through August, with an average relative humidity of 78%.

Rainfall

August is the month with the most rainfall. Rain falls for 25 days and accumulates 131mm (5.16") of precipitation.

Sea temperature

August through October, with an average sea temperature of 29°C (84.2°F), are months with the warmest seawater.
Note: Temperatures between 25°C (77°F) and 29°C (84.2°F) are excellent for swimming, diving, and other water activities, providing comfort and enjoyment for extended periods without discomfort.

Daylight

In Bávaro, the average length of the day in August is 12h and 44min.
On the first day of August in Bávaro, sunrise is at 06:11 and sunset at 19:08.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:18 and sunset at 18:48 AST.

Sunshine

In Bávaro, Dominican Republic, the average sunshine in August is 9h.
